Ciliary Dyskinesia v0.45 CFAP43 Elena Savva gene: CFAP43 was added
gene: CFAP43 was added to Ciliary Dyskinesia. Sources: Expert Review
Mode of inheritance for gene: CFAP43 was set to BOTH monoallelic and biallelic (but BIALLELIC mutations cause a more SEVERE disease form), autosomal or pseudoautosomal
Publications for gene: CFAP43 were set to PMID: 31884020; 28552195; 31004071; 29449551
Phenotypes for gene: CFAP43 were set to Hydrocephalus, normal pressure, 1 236690; Spermatogenic failure 19 617592
Review for gene: CFAP43 was set to GREEN
Added comment: aka WDR96

PMID: 31884020 - animal models (mouse, frog) demonstrate the protein localizes in ciliary axoneme and is involved in MOTILE cilia movement. LOF CFAP43 caused mucus acucmulation in airways, impaired spermatogenesis and hydrocephalus.

PMID: 28552195 - 3x chet (bilallelic PTCs or chet PTC/missense) with abnormal sperm motility. Null mouse models were also infertile.

PMID: 31004071 - one family with a heterozygous nonsense and AD inheritance of late onset hydrocephaly (checked in Mutalyzer, variant is NMD predicted). Abnormal cilia observed from mucosa sample. Null mice also show abnormal sperm and dilation of brain ventricles.

PMID: 29449551 - reports an additional 10 patients with either homozygous PTCs or chet PTC/missense who were infertile with flagella defects

Summary: single report of AD hydrocephaly
